Back in 2002, Modest Mouse frontman Isaac Brock released an album with an enigmatic band called Ugly Casanova. On October 30, Sub Pop will reissue that album, Sharpen Your Teeth, which has been out of print on vinyl for a long time. It comes with four bonus tracks including an unreleased track culled from the album’s sessions, “They Devised A Plan to Fuck Forever”.

The album was recorded at Glacial Pace Studios in Oregon and produced by Brock and Brian Deck. Sharpen Your Teeth features Brock, Deck, John Orth of Holopaw, Tim Rutili of Califone and Red Red Meat, Pall Jenkins of the Black Heart Procession, and others.
